h5语音聊天SDK在语音识别方面的技术难点有哪些?

随着互联网技术的不断发展,语音聊天已成为社交、办公等领域的重要沟通方式。h5语音聊天SDK作为一种新兴的语音技术,在语音识别方面具有广泛的应用前景。然而,语音识别技术在h5语音聊天SDK中仍存在一些技术难点。本文将详细探讨h5语音聊天SDK在语音识别方面的技术难点。

一、语音信号处理

  1. 语音信号采集

在h5语音聊天SDK中,首先需要采集用户的语音信号。然而,在实际应用中,语音信号采集存在以下难点:

(1)噪声干扰:在嘈杂环境中,如公共场所、交通工具等,语音信号会受到噪声干扰,导致语音识别准确率降低。

(2)语音质量:不同用户、不同设备的语音质量参差不齐,这给语音识别带来了挑战。


  1. 语音信号预处理

为了提高语音识别准确率,需要对采集到的语音信号进行预处理。以下是语音信号预处理过程中可能遇到的技术难点:

(1)噪声抑制:如何有效去除噪声,提高语音质量,是语音信号预处理的关键。

(2)说话人识别:在多人语音聊天场景中,如何准确识别说话人,避免混淆,是语音信号预处理的重要任务。

二、语音识别算法

  1. 语音特征提取

语音特征提取是语音识别的关键环节,主要包括以下难点:

(1)特征选择:如何从海量语音特征中选取对识别任务有重要影响的特征,是语音特征提取的关键。

(2)特征提取算法:如何从语音信号中提取有效特征,是语音识别算法研究的热点。


  1. 语音识别模型

语音识别模型是语音识别的核心,主要包括以下难点:

(1)模型选择:如何根据实际应用场景选择合适的语音识别模型,是语音识别研究的重要方向。

(2)模型训练:如何优化模型参数,提高识别准确率,是语音识别研究的难点。

三、跨语言和方言识别

  1. 跨语言识别

在全球化背景下,跨语言语音识别成为h5语音聊天SDK的重要需求。然而,跨语言语音识别存在以下难点:

(1)语言差异:不同语言的语音特征差异较大,如何有效处理语言差异,是跨语言语音识别的难点。

(2)语言资源:跨语言语音数据资源相对匮乏,如何有效利用现有资源,是跨语言语音识别的挑战。


  1. 方言识别

方言识别是h5语音聊天SDK在语音识别方面的又一难点。以下为方言识别过程中可能遇到的技术难点:

(1)方言差异:不同方言的语音特征差异较大,如何有效处理方言差异,是方言识别的难点。

(2)方言资源:方言语音数据资源相对匮乏,如何有效利用现有资源,是方言识别的挑战。

四、实时性和低功耗

  1. 实时性

在h5语音聊天SDK中,实时性是语音识别的重要指标。以下为实时性方面可能遇到的技术难点:

(1)算法优化:如何优化算法,提高语音识别速度,是实时性方面的难点。

(2)硬件加速:如何利用硬件加速技术,提高语音识别效率,是实时性方面的挑战。


  1. 低功耗

在移动设备上,低功耗是语音识别技术的重要要求。以下为低功耗方面可能遇到的技术难点:

(1)算法优化:如何优化算法,降低功耗,是低功耗方面的难点。

(2)硬件选择:如何选择合适的硬件,降低功耗,是低功耗方面的挑战。

总之,h5语音聊天SDK在语音识别方面存在诸多技术难点。为了克服这些难点,研究人员需要不断探索和创新,提高语音识别技术在h5语音聊天SDK中的应用效果。

猜你喜欢:IM出海